time_read17mn de lecture

Optimiser WordPress avec Cloudflare : comment faire ?

29 avril 2024

Optimiser Wordpress avec Cloudflare : comment faire ?

Dans cet article, vous allez voir connaître la méthode permettant de rendre votre site WordPress plus rapide. En effet, l’alliance de W3 Total Cache et Cloudflare qui vont être mis en avant vont vous permettre de gagner en rapidité.

WordPress est de nos jours, l’un des CMS les plus utilisé dans le monde. Dès son installation, il vous est possible de publier des articles et des pages afin de les mettre à disposition des internautes. Cependant, il est important d’optimiser WordPress. De ce fait, certains réglages sont à effectuer. En effet, il est à noter qu’un site trop lent vous fera perdre en visibilité.

Pourquoi utiliser Cloudflare ?

L’utilisation d’un réseau comme Cloudflare doit être envisagé car il permet de réduire considérablement le temps de chargement des pages de votre site. Outre cela, vous bénéficiez d’une sécurité et d’une protection améliorées. En effet, il protège votre présence en ligne et votre disponibilité en cas d’attaque DDoS.

Comment améliorer la vitesse de chargement en utilisant W3 Total Cache et Cloudflare ?

Outre le choix de votre hébergement WordPress, les améliorations suivantes ne sont pas à négliger et vont vous permettre de réduire considérablement le temps de chargement de vos pages :

  • W3 Total Cache : Ce plugin s’installe en quelques clics sur votre site WordPress. Il permet de servir à vos visiteurs des fichiers statiques à la place de votre contenu dynamique. De ce fait, le contenu de votre site sera chargé plus rapidement.
  • Cloudflare : Ce système va permettre d’augmenter de manière considérable le chargement de vos pages. En effet, sans CDN, le contenu sera chargé à compter de l’emplacement du serveur uniquement. Un CDN va modifier cela en créant plusieurs versions à plusieurs endroits à travers le monde. De ce fait, le visiteur chargera vos pages à partir d’un emplacement proche de chez lui. Cette proximité permet de réduire le temps de chargement afin d’accélérer votre site Web.

Installer W3 Total Cache

La première chose à effectuer est d’installer W3 Total Cache sur votre site WordPress. Pour cela, connectez-vous à votre tableau de bord, cliquez sur « Extensions » puis sur « Ajouter« . Recherchez le plugin et cliquez sur le bouton ‘Installer« .

Optimiser WordPress avec Cloudflare

Cliquez ensuite sur le bouton « Activer« .

Optimiser WordPress avec Cloudflare

Configurer W3 Total Cache

Dans le menu se trouvant côté gauche de votre Tableau de bord WordPress, cliquez sur « Performance » puis sur « Paramètres généraux« . Cette page vous permet d’activer et désactiver certaines fonctions selon vos besoins. Nous allons voir ci-dessous, les différentes fonctions disponibles :

  • Général : Cette fonctionnalité vous permet d’activer par défaut toutes les options disponibles sur W3 Total Cache. Cependant, comme le nom de domaine va aussi être lié à Cloudflare, certaines fonctions sont inutile. De ce fait, il n’est pas nécessaire de cliquer sur ce bouton.
  • Mise en cache de la page : Cette fonction va permettre d’améliorer considérablement les performances de votre site et rendre la navigation plus rapide. De ce fait, il est indispensable d’activer cette fonction et choisir en « Page Cache Method », « Disque: Amélioré ».
  • Minifier : Comme beaucoup de systèmes de mise en cache, il vous est possible de minifier le code de votre site Web. La minification permet de réduire le code HTML, CSS et JS de votre site. Il est inutile d’activer cette fonction dans la mesure où Cloudflare peut le faire.
  • Mise en cache de la base de données : Il s’agit de l’endroit où toutes les informations (articles et pages) sont conservées. Il est déconseillé d’activer cette fonction si vous êtes sur un hébergement mutualisé car cela peut prendre plus de ressources et ralentir la vitesse de votre site Web.
  • Mise en cache navigateur : Il est indispensable d’activer cette fonction dans la mesure où elle va mettre des ressources statiques dans les navigateurs de vos visiteurs. Cela permettra d’éviter de recharger tout le contenu à chaque visite.

Configurer la mise en cache de page avec W3 Total Cache

Optimiser WordPress avec Cloudflare

Pour cela, cliquez sur « Performance » puis sur l’onglet « mise en cache de page« . Vous y trouverez différentes rubriques vous permettant la mise en cache de la page d’accueil, du flux, le cache SSL et le cache des utilisateurs connectés. Assurez-vous que ces cases soient bien cochées.

Configurez ensuite le préchargement du cache avec un intervalle de mise à jour de 900 secondes. Une fois que toute la configuration est mise en place, rendez-vous dans la brique « Extensions » de votre menu « Performance » afin d’activer Cloudflare.

Optimiser WordPress avec Cloudflare

Comment configurer Cloudflare ?

Maintenant que vous avez réussi à configurer W3C Total Cache, rendez-vous sur le site de Cloudflare afin de vous y inscrire. Une fois connecté, vous allez être invité à ajouter votre site Web. Introduisez le domaine et cliquez sur « Add Site« .

Optimiser WordPress avec Cloudflare

Suivez ensuite la procédure jusqu’à la vérification des DNS. Cloudflare va vous présenter le scan des différents enregistrements trouvés. Il est nécessaire de vérifier les informations affichées avant de continuer. En effet, à cette étape, il vous est possible d’ajouter des enregistrements ou d’en modifier.

Optimiser WordPress avec Cloudflare

Assurez-vous aussi que l’icône se trouvant derrière la Zone de votre nom de domaine est bien en Orange. En effet, cela signifiera que Cloudflare accélérera le trafic pour cette Zone.

La dernière étape de configuration consiste à mettre à jour les serveurs de noms chez votre hébergeur Web pour les serveurs de noms communiqués par Cloudflare. Une fois les serveurs de noms modifiés, il vous faudra patienter jusqu’à 24 heures afin que ceci soit pris en compte et fonctionnel pour votre nom de domaine.

Ne vous inquiétez pas, si la configuration est effectuée comme indiqué dans cet article, votre site Web ne connaîtra pas de temps d’arrêt.

Activation de Cloudflare sur W3 Total Cache

Maintenant que vous avez configuré Cloudflare, la dernière chose à faire est de synchroniser Cloudflare à W3 Total Cache. Pour cela, retournez sur votre Tableau de bord WordPress, cliquez sur « Performance » puis sur « Extensions« . Cliquez enfin sur « Réglages » se trouvant sous l’extension Cloudflare.

Optimiser WordPress avec Cloudflare

Derrière « Spécifier les informations d’identification du compte« , cliquez sur le bouton « Autoriser« . Une nouvelle fenêtre va s’ouvrir vous demandant d’indiquer l’adresse email rattaché à votre compte Cloudflare ainsi que la clé API. La clé API peut être généré en vous rendant sur votre espace Cloudflare, cliquez sur « mon compte » puis sur « Clé API » pour cela.

Conclusion optimisation site WordPress

Vous êtes désormais en mesure d’optimiser WordPress en utilisant Cloudflare et W3 Total Cache. Une fois cette configuration effectuée, il vous faudra patienter jusqu’à 24 heures afin que l’optimisation soit effective, le temps que les nouveaux serveurs DNS se propagent.

J’espère que cet article vous a été utile et je vous remercie de m’avoir lu jusqu’ici 🙂

Hébergement WordPress LWS

Avatar de l'auteur

Auteur de l'article

Fabrice S.

Développeur web full stack et consultant SEO. Je suis Fabrice, expert en développement web Full Stack, consultant SEO et noms de domaine chez LWS 🌐. J'adore partager mes astuces et mon expérience pour vous aider à briller sur le web ! Suivez-moi pour des conseils pratiques et fun 😊.

Il y a 207 jours

note article

5/5 (179 votes)

Commentaires (0)
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ée.

White Book for other Category

Hébergement Web LWS - 3 mois offerts

Hébergement Web Starter LWS GRATUIT pendant 3 mois ! 🚀

Cette offre exclusive comprend tout ce dont vous avez besoin pour créer votre site web GRATUITEMENT : Hébergement 250Go SSD, 5 sites webs hébergeables, WordPress et autres CMS en 1 clic, support réactif 7J/7, serveurs en France...